Newspaper gets another extension till Friday

Craig Mitchell. Senior Vice President of Finance at Morris Communications Company, LLC, announced that it has obtained an extension until September 4, 2009 to make two semi-annual interest payments of $9.7 million on its senior subordinated notes originally due Feb. 1, 2009 and August 3, 2009.

Another week forbearance for The Record publisher

Morris Publishing Group, LLC announced Friday that it has obtained an extension until August 28, 2009 to make two semi-annual interest payments of $9.7 million on its senior subordinated notes originally due Feb. 1, 2009 and August 3, 2009.

FDIC closes Colonial Bank – sold to BB&T

With three branches in the St. Augustine area and two more in Palm Coast, Colonial Bank has been added to the list of banks that have been closed by federal regulators.
